Credentials that actually matter

Certifications are not marketing fluff. In Australia, a reliable personal trainer holds at least a Certificate IV in Physical fitness and enrollment with AUSactive. These show baseline education and learning and arrangement to professional requirements. Present Emergency Treatment and CPR are non-negotiable. For details populations, search for extra training. Pre and postnatal clients gain from an instructor who has studied pelvic health considerations. Masters professional athletes deserve someone fluent in handling recovery and injury danger. If your trainer trains young people professional athletes, a Dealing with Kids Check is essential.

Insurance becomes part of the trust fund formula. An expert trainer brings public liability and expert indemnity insurance. Outside team sessions in public areas occasionally require council licenses. Trustworthy coaches will certainly know and adhere to those policies, specifically in hectic places like Royal Botanic Gardens or Albert Park.

A final credential that you will not see on a certificate beings in just how a train onboards you. A correct consumption includes a health screen, injury history, present activity summary, and clear goal setting. Standard steps could consist of a movement display, straightforward strength standards, or a submaximal cardio examination. If a coach prepares to market you a 12 week shred prior to they understand your training age or your job timetable, keep looking.

What an audio training procedure looks like

Here is what you ought to expect when a program is constructed well. It begins with a simple assessment, nothing that seems like a circus technique. An activity check may include bodyweight squats, a hip hinge pattern, a push and draw, and a lunge. For cardio, possibly a six min stroll test, a 1.6 kilometre run if appropriate, or a bike increase while viewing heart price. These touchpoints established a safe starting tons and offer you reference points to beat.

Programming is phased. Early weeks stress strategy, develop resistance, and establish routines. Quantity and intensity rise delicately. For a beginner, 2 to 3 complete body sessions weekly is enough. Exercises gather around huge patterns, squat, joint, press, pull, carry, revolve. The instructor layers accessory work to shore up weak links. Much better instructors will clarify why, not just what. When you recognize the factor behind pace cup crouches or split stance rows, you purchase in.

Progressions are not random. A lifter may use a dual development system, functioning a weight until it hits the top of a representative array with excellent type, after that pushing the load. An endurance professional athlete could circle with easy cardio growth, regulated threshold job, and speed, making use of RPE or pace ranges set by testing. Recuperation is built in. Deload weeks rest on the calendar prior to your body demands them.

Tracking is basic. You will see session logs that keep in mind weights, associates, sets, and just how those collections felt. You and your fitness instructor may use an application like TrueCoach or Trainerize, or a shared spread sheet gets the job done equally as well. For cardio, you might track resting heart price, heart price recovery after tough periods, and how your legs feel on very easy days. For some clients HRV adds signal. It needs to never end up being a proclivity. The objective is to overview choices, not worship data.

Nutrition and recovery, inside scope

An individual fitness instructor is not a dietitian. In Australia, just an Accredited Practising Dietitian Fitness Australia accredited trainer or an effectively certified nourishment expert must suggest medical nutrition treatment. A good fitness instructor stays within range and collaborates when needed. Still, many people do not need a bespoke dish plan to begin. They need functional pushes that mirror their life.

In Melbourne that could imply exchanging the office pastry for high healthy protein yoghurt and fruit at morning tea, buying a lunch bowl with extra vegetables and a lean protein, and readjusting portion size at dinner. If you like your weekend brunch at Lygon Road, keep it, after that trim elsewhere. A trainer could suggest a healthy protein target by body weight variety, hydration objectives, and a basic system to track 2 to 3 key routines rather than counting every kilojoule. If you have a clinical condition, allergic reactions, or an intricate goal, your fitness instructor should refer you to a dietitian and afterwards help you apply the plan in the gym.

Recovery rests on equivalent ground with training. Sleep is king. A coach who educates property legal representatives at 6 a.m. Knows that three consecutive nights of five hours is a warning. They might change shows, relocating a heavy session to Wednesday when court is not impending. Stress administration, flexibility windows after long tram experiences, and basic cells care belong to the coaching conversation. The most effective programs value your whole life, not simply the hour on the floor.

Case notes from around town

A software program lead in the CBD, early forties, wished to reverse 12 years of workdesk tightness and anxiety weight. We established toughness sessions on Monday and Thursday, a brisk 40 minute stroll at lunch on Tuesday, and pace periods around The Tan on Friday if his week remained sane. He logged nutrition practices instead of calories, a couple of tweaks at a time. Over six months he relocated from 60 kilo deadlifts to 120 for triples, cut his 1.6 kilometre run from 8:12 to 6:52, and lost nine kilograms without a crash.

A masters runner in Sandringham had a string of calf bone pressures. She lifted with me once a week in a small studio near Brighton and ran four days. We added heavy seated calf increases, split squats, and plyometric developments with controlled volumes. Her instructor supplied run programming, I managed strength, and we synced strategies every fortnight. She went back to consistent training and ran an individual ideal at 10 kilometres 3 months later on, not by running much more, but by running smarter and raising as insurance.

A new dad in Preston balanced five hours of rest and a young child that adored 4 a.m. Wake-ups. We trimmed heavy training to 2 days of 45 mins each, included short walks with the pram, and kept progress slow-moving. He acquired stamina within his data transfer, learned to shut down sessions early when sleep broke down, and constructed a base that will certainly continue when life steadies.

These tales underline the exact same lesson. Precision beats intensity, and consistency defeats perfection.

Frequently Ask Questions about Personal Trainer


How much does a personal trainer cost in Melbourne?

Personal trainer costs in Melbourne typically range from $50 to $120 per hour for one-on-one sessions. Prices vary depending on the trainer’s experience, location, and type of training. Group sessions are usually cheaper per person. Additional fees may apply for specialized programs or assessments.

Is $300 a month a lot for a personal trainer?

Paying $300 per month for personal training can be considered moderate if it includes multiple sessions per week. The cost is lower than private hourly sessions but higher than group training. The value depends on the frequency and quality of sessions. Comparing local rates helps assess whether it is reasonable.

How much is a 1 hour PT session?

A one-hour personal training session typically costs between $50 and $120 in Melbourne. Rates vary depending on the trainer’s qualifications, experience, and the facility. Specialized training or premium locations may charge more. Discounts may apply for package bookings.

Is 2 PT sessions a week enough?

Two personal training sessions per week are generally sufficient for building strength and improving fitness for most people. Consistency with workouts outside sessions can enhance results. Beginners may benefit from more frequent guidance initially. Recovery time is also important to prevent injury.

How many sessions do I need with a trainer?

The number of sessions needed depends on individual goals, fitness level, and program intensity. Beginners may require 1–3 sessions per week initially. Experienced clients may need fewer sessions for maintenance or specialized goals. Progress should be assessed periodically to adjust frequency.
